Our take

Boss The Scent Pure Accord For Him opens with a nervy, raw ginger that snaps like a fresh root split open. It’s a sharp, almost peppery jolt of citrus-adjacent heat, but before that bite can overwhelm, a sticky, syrupy Maninka fruit drops in, jammy and dark. The white suede base feels less like a luxury jacket and more like the worn interior of a secondhand car on a summer afternoon, powdery and surprisingly musky. This is a synthetic playground, but it’s a well-tuned one, leaning into a fuzzy, fresh-spicy sweetness that never turns cloying. The overall character is like a glass of ginger tea steeped with overripe fruit and left to cool on a leather armchair, pleasant but fleeting.

The numbers back up what your skin will tell you in under an hour. Longevity fades into a faint ghost after three or four hours, and sillage sticks close enough that only a hug will catch it. That makes it a reactive, not proactive, fragrance. It suits the man who wants a subtle, modern accent for a spring daytime coffee date or a summer office where everything must be low-key. Skip it if you need a statement, something to fill a room or survive a night out. This stuff whispers and then disappears.

When it works, it works as a soft, clean sweetness with a leathery dusting, but it’s a shame the maninka and ginger are so quickly muffled by the suede. For a fresh spicy fruity accord, it feels like a sketch rather than a finished painting. Wear it on a warm Wednesday when you want to smell good without smelling like you tried. Just don’t expect anyone to remember you by it.
